Context:
- Diabetes mellitus (DM) is a significant risk factor for chronic heart failure (CHF), affecting 10-15% of DM patients compared to 3% in non-DM individuals.
- Hyperglycemia and insulin resistance in DM are directly implicated in the pathogenesis of diastolic dysfunction and CHF.
- The co-occurrence of DM and CHF presents a complex clinical challenge with a poor prognosis.

Summary:
- DM is an independent risk factor for CHF, with higher prevalence and poorer outcomes in affected patients.
- Diagnosis follows established guidelines, including ECG, natriuretic peptide testing, and echocardiography.
- Standard CHF pharmacotherapy (ACEIs, ARBs, BBs, diuretics, etc.) is indicated, alongside meticulous glucose control.
- Certain antidiabetic drugs (glitazones, metformin) have contraindications based on CHF severity (NYHA classes).

Abstract:
Chronic heart failure (CHF) in patients with diabetes mellitus (DM) is a condition that is frequent and has a poor prognosis. Diabetes mellitus is an independent risk factor for CHF and vice versa. CHF is found in 10-15% of the patients with DM compared to 3% in individuals without DM. Apart from CHD and hypertension, hyperglycaemia and insulin resistance are directly linked to the development of diastolic dysfunction and to CHF. According to the stepwise diagnostic procedure recommended by the ESC in its guidelines from 2005, if heart failure is suspected, the disease should first be diagnosed by ECG, X-ray, or testing for natriuretic peptide and followed by echocardiography when test results are abnormal. Treatment of CHF in patients with diabetes mellitus is the same as that for nondiabetic patients and includes the use of ACEIs, ARBSs (as an alternative to or in combination with ACEIs), BBs, diuretics (in particular loop diuretics), aldosterone inhibitors and digitalis. Most importantly, meticulous glucose control is a must in patients with diabetes mellitus and CHF to improve prognosis. Contraindications for antidiabetic drugs such as glitazones for CHF-NYHA classes I-IV and metformin for NYHA classes III-IV need to be considered in patients with CHF and diabetes mellitus.
